Biography

Coddington grew up in the seaside town of Raglan. She started playing drums from age 11, and guitar from age 14. By 16 she was fronting and writing for her first band, Handsome Geoffery, which won New Zealand's national student music competition, Smokefree Rockquest, in 1998.
